Bitcoin Blockchain Size: What You Need to Know
Understanding the Blockchain Size
The size of the Bitcoin blockchain refers to the total amount of data required to store the complete transaction history of the network. Each block in the blockchain contains a list of transactions, and as new blocks are added, the size of the blockchain increases. This data is distributed across a network of nodes, with each node maintaining a copy of the entire blockchain.
Historical Growth
When Bitcoin was launched in 2009, the blockchain was only a few megabytes in size. However, with the increasing popularity of Bitcoin and the rise in transaction volume, the blockchain has grown significantly. By the end of 2013, the blockchain size was around 10 GB. Fast forward to 2024, and it has surpassed 500 GB. This rapid growth can be attributed to several factors, including:
- Increased Transaction Volume: More transactions mean more data that needs to be recorded and stored.
- Block Size and Frequency: The size of each block and the frequency at which new blocks are added also influence the blockchain's growth.
- SegWit and Layer 2 Solutions: Technologies like Segregated Witness (SegWit) and Layer 2 solutions (e.g., Lightning Network) help to optimize and offload some data, but they still contribute to the overall size.
Implications for Users
- Storage Requirements: Running a full node requires substantial storage capacity. As the blockchain grows, users need to allocate more disk space. For many, this may be a limiting factor.
- Bandwidth and Synchronization: Larger blockchain sizes mean more data needs to be downloaded and verified. This can impact synchronization times and require more bandwidth.
- Access and Security: Full nodes provide more security to the network by validating transactions and blocks. However, the increased storage requirements might discourage some users from running full nodes.
Future Trends
The Bitcoin blockchain will continue to grow as more transactions are processed and new blocks are added. Several trends might influence its future growth:
- Technological Advances: Ongoing improvements in technology could lead to better compression techniques and more efficient storage solutions.
- Network Upgrades: Protocol upgrades and network changes could impact how data is stored and managed.
- Adoption of Layer 2 Solutions: Increased use of solutions like the Lightning Network could help manage on-chain data and reduce the rate at which the blockchain grows.
Conclusion
The Bitcoin blockchain size is a crucial factor for users and developers alike. It reflects the network's growth and can influence the operational aspects of running a node. As Bitcoin continues to evolve, understanding these dynamics will be essential for anyone involved in the cryptocurrency space. Keeping an eye on advancements and changes will help users and developers navigate the challenges associated with blockchain size and ensure the continued efficiency and security of the Bitcoin network.
Top Comments
No Comments Yet